Daily reflections, Day ten, Forgiveness is the path to peace


Day ten
Forgiveness is the path to peace



“Miracles are natural. When they do not occur something has gone wrong.” T-1.1.6:1-2

The most natural thing is to be at peace and at one with God because that is our natural inheritance. When we do not experience this something has gone wrong.

In Unitarian Universalism we covenant together to affirm and promote the inherent worth and dignity of every person. This affirmation and promotion is the most natural thing in the world. When this affirmation and promotion of the inherent worth and dignity of every person is not apparent and does not exist something has gone wrong.

When we feel angry, frustrated, resentful, fearful, like a victim, we become aware of a forgiveness opportunity and we are able to choose to give up making other people and things unhappy for our unhappiness.

If we are feeling unhappy something has gone wrong and it is not with external events, it is with our choice in how we are responding to those external events. When we are unhappy, it is a good time to pray that the Spirit help us give up making the things of the ego world responsible for our unhappiness. In this giving up of making other people people and things responsible for our unhappiness we no longer are choosing to be a victim and we become aware of the peace that comes with our awareness of being One with God.

Remember today, that you are never upset for the reason you think and that peace and joy arise when we realize that there is a better way.
